If you’re a veteran, service member, or military-affiliated student looking to study electroneurodiagnostic/electroencephalographic technology/technologist, you’ve come to the right place. This ranking highlights 20 colleges that stand out for veteran electroneurodiagnostic/electroencephalographic technology/technologist students, using our 2026 methodology.

This ranking is based on the factors that matter most to veteran and military-affiliated students: affordability and veteran financial benefits (including GI Bill and Yellow Ribbon support), academic quality, on-campus veteran resources and support services, veteran-friendly policies, and the size of the veteran student community. So you can compare your options, College Factual analyzed colleges nationwide, drawing primarily on U.S. Department of Education data (IPEDS and College Scorecard).
